So a friend of mine who builds some great bows was having a moving sale a few years back and on a picnic table was a pile of old busted up bows and this one half completed 64" longbow with dried glue all over it. The auctioneer ended up selling the table for $12.50 per item. I saw that the bow looked rather stout so I bought it.
The riser is Purple Heart and the limbs elm. I never made a bow before so I just began sanding and rounding the edges and shaping the grip to what felt good to me. This process has taken over a year.
So, I started shooting the bow and it shoots great! Now I'm looking at my beautiful custom bows and not wanting to use them. So I'm carrying around this ugly bow and shooting darts with it. It ended up being a smooth pulling 75#@27" and I love it.
